Abstract

Phonon dispersion relations of CuBr having zincblende-type structure were measured by the neutron inelastic scattering technique with a triple-axis spectrometer. The dispersion curves measured at 77 K were well described by the shell model with 14 parameters which has been successfully applied to explain the data for GaAs, GaP and InSb. The elastic constants were obtained both from sound velocities estimated from the initial slopes of acoustic phonon dispersion curves and from the shell-model-fit. The optical phonon energies at the zone center are in good agreement with the Raman scattering data. The temperature dependence of phonon scattering was also measured. It was found that the phonon energies as well as the shape of phonon peaks varied considerably with temperature, suggesting that the effect of anharmonicity is remarkable in CuBr even at room temperature. © 1976, THE PHYSICAL SOCIETY OF JAPAN.
